The Seybold Building is a famous historic building in Miami, Florida. It's known as a big center for jewelry stores. The building was designed by architects Kiehnel and Elliott. It was built in two main parts. The first three floors were finished in 1921. John Seybold, who owned the building, ran a bakery and candy shop there. Later, in 1925, seven more floors were added. Today, the Seybold Building is a special historic landmark in Miami. It's also part of the Downtown Miami Historic District.

A Look Back at the Seybold Building's History

The Seybold Building has a cool history that started with John Seybold. He moved to Miami a long time ago and opened a bakery. Even after his first bakery burned down, he started another one! He then created a shopping area, which people called an "arcade" back then. This arcade eventually grew into the 10-story Seybold Building we see today.

How Jewelers Made It Their Home

In the 1960s, the first jewelry store opened in the building. Jeffrey Buchwald, who came from Hungary, moved his jewelry shop to Miami. His family's business, Buchwald Jewelers, is still there today. Jeff Buchwald remembers visiting the store as a kid. He said that when his family first moved in, there were only a few jewelry shops and many lawyer offices. Over time, more and more jewelers arrived.

A big reason the Seybold Building became a jewelry hub was because many Cuban jewelers moved to the United States. They left their homes and businesses in Cuba and looked for new places to work. Mario's Casting, another family-run jewelry business, came to the U.S. in 1969. Martha Camero, one of the owners, shared that many Cuban jewelers came to downtown Miami in the 1970s. As more jewelers moved into the Seybold Building, the lawyers moved out. Soon, almost every floor was filled with different kinds of jewelry businesses!

What You'll Find Inside Today

Most of the shops in the Seybold Building today are still about jewelry and watches. You can find places that sell diamonds, fix watches, or even cut gemstones. If you need something special or just a watch repair, this Miami landmark is a great place to visit.

From people who set stones to those who plate gold, and from watch repair experts to big jewelry makers, the Seybold Building is full of beautiful items. It's also a place where you can hear amazing stories of people who built new lives and businesses in Miami.

Awards and Recognition

The Seybold Jewelry Building was recognized for its quality. In 2009, the Miami New Times newspaper named it the "Best Place to Buy a Diamond Ring."
